columnize-0.3.7:Python库的高效输出格式化工具

版权申诉
0 下载量 19 浏览量 更新于2024-10-28 收藏 9KB GZ 举报
这个库的设计初哀是为了解决在命令行界面中展示列表或字典等数据时,由于宽度限制,导致无法有效地展示全部数据内容的问题。columnize-0.3.7可以将数据分割成多个列,使得数据能够更加清晰、整齐地展示在终端界面上。" 在Python中,columnize库的使用非常简单。用户只需要导入库并调用columnize函数,就可以将传入的列表或者字典数据格式化输出。该库支持多种参数配置,用户可以根据自己的需求,自定义输出的列数、对齐方式、分隔符等。 columnize库的兼容性较好,支持多种Python版本,包括Python 2和Python 3。这使得它能够在绝大多数Python环境中使用。而且,它还支持在IPython或Jupyter Notebook中使用,使其成为了数据分析和科学计算中一个非常有用的工具。 在Python开发中,处理数据的展示是一个非常重要的环节。无论是进行数据分析,还是调试代码,都可能需要将各种数据结构以可视化的方式输出。columnize库提供的列式输出方法,不仅提高了数据展示的可读性,也使得数据比较变得更为直观。 columnize库的文件名称为columnize-0.3.7.tar.gz,这是一个源代码包,用户需要先进行解压缩操作,然后在Python环境中通过setup.py安装后方可使用。用户可以通过pip等Python包管理工具,快速完成安装和卸载操作。 值得一提的是,columnize库的版本号为0.3.7,这表明它是该库的第三个大版本的第七个小版本更新,一般来说,这样的版本号代表着库的稳定性和成熟度较高。但是,用户在使用时还是需要关注该库的更新记录和社区反馈,以确保它能够满足最新的使用需求。 在使用columnize库时,用户需要注意的是,由于它是一个用于终端输出的库,因此它并不适合用于Web开发或图形界面应用程序中。此外,columnize库的功能相对单一,它仅仅提供了一种数据展示方式,对于数据处理和分析的功能有限。 总的来说,columnize是一个非常实用的Python库,特别是对于那些需要在命令行界面中清晰展示数据的开发者来说,它是一个不可或缺的工具。对于Python后端开发、数据分析以及日常的调试任务,columnize库都能提供很好的帮助。
440 浏览量
2025-02-28 上传
在当今化工行业转型升级的大潮中,智慧化工园区作为推动绿色、创新、高质量发展的关键力量,正逐步成为行业发展的新趋势。随着国家政策的不断引导和推动,智慧化工园区的建设已不仅仅是提升管理服务水平的手段,更是实现安全生产、环境保护和应急响应能力全面提升的重要途径。从提升重大危险源监测、隐患排查到完善风险分级管控机制,智慧化工园区利用信息化、智能化技术,构建了一个全方位、多层次的安全、环保、应急救援一体化管理平台。 智慧化工园区以安全、便捷、高效、节能、物联为核心理念,通过深度融合云计算、物联网、人脸识别、大数据分析、人工智能等先进技术,实现了园区生产、车辆、人员、环境、能源等关键环节的智能化管理。在基础网络方面,园区不仅实现了全千兆光纤接入,还覆盖了5G信号、NB-IoT信号和WiFi网络,为万物互联提供了坚实的基础。智慧安监作为园区的核心板块,通过企业安全云服务、安全文化宣传教育、舆情信息监管、风险分级管控、隐患排查治理以及重大危险源管理等功能,构建了从源头到末端的全过程安全监管体系。特别是企业一张表功能,实现了企业档案的数字化管理,为精准施策提供了有力支持。此外,智慧园区还通过物联网监测预警系统,利用智能终端设备对园区内的各类风险进行实时监测和预警,确保园区安全无虞。 在智慧节能与环保方面,园区通过智能仪表监测电、水、冷、气等能耗数据,实现能源管理的精细化和节能减排。智慧应急系统则融合了指挥调度、辅助决策等功能,能够在突发情况下迅速响应,有效处置。智慧环保系统则利用物联网技术和大数据分析,实现了环境质量的自动监测和预警,为环保部门提供了精准的执法依据。同时,智慧物流、智慧安防、智慧楼宇等系统的引入,进一步提升了园区的智能化水平和运行效率。这些系统的集成应用,不仅让园区的管理更加便捷高效,还极大地提升了园区的整体竞争力和可持续发展能力。对于正在筹备或优化智慧化工园区建设方案的读者来说,这份解决方案无疑提供了宝贵的参考和灵感,让智慧化工园区的建设之路变得更加清晰和有趣。